It’s the perfect blend between the … The toothbrush moustache is a style of moustache in which the sides are vertical (or nearly vertical) rather than tapered, giving the hairs the appearance of the bristles on a toothbrush that are attached to the nose. It was made famous by such comedians as Charlie Chaplin and Oliver Hardy. The style first became popular in … Se mer In the United States The toothbrush originally became popular in the late 19th century, in the United States. Nettet29. aug. 2016 · Today moustaches have waned in popularity somewhat, and you’ll notice they’re sported mainly by middle-aged men. The youth find the moustache a little old fashioned, a throwback to another era. According to one poll, 77% of Turkish men had moustaches in 1993; 63% in 1997 and 34% in 2011.
